Mobility Parking

Parking concessions are granted to people with disabilities who have applied and received a mobility parking permit or mobility card. The card must be clearly displayed on the dashboard. The membership number must be visible whilst parked in designated mobility parks. This includes public and private car parks, e.g. shopping malls, hospitals and supermarkets. Concessions also apply to P30 and P60 time restricted parking areas.


The parking concession scheme for people with physical disabilities


All mobility applications have to be certified by a medical specialist. Your nearest CCS Disability Action branch has application forms or you can download one below:

Your disability mobility card must be displayed inside the front windscreen only when the member is using the vehicle.  Abuse of the concession will result in the cancellation of your membership.  If you are issued with a parking infringement and your card has not been displayed correctly, the infringement stands.

Mobility card holders can also park for double the time restrictions in P30, P60 parking restrictions, provided the mobility card is displayed on the dashboard and visible from the outside of the vehicle.
